TomTom, a Massachusetts company, announced this week that Dunkin Donuts has been added to their Point of Interest (POI) database. This will let TomTom users find over 4,400 Dunkin Donuts locations and 2,700 Baskin-Robbins locations all over the country with great ease.

Dunkin’ Brands CEO Jon Luther was interviewed on CNBC by anchor Maria Bartiromo last week (link here). Luther discussed the purchase of the Dunkin’ Donuts chain by three private equity firms, and laid out the company’s national expansion plans.
